Electrical Service Technician
Jet Industries, Inc. is a nationwide, family-owned contractor that has been in business since 1977, focusing on various construction trades. The Electrical Service Technician is responsible for the maintenance, installation, troubleshooting, and repair of electrical systems in residential and commercial settings.

Responsibilities
Install, repair, and maintain electrical systems, including wiring, breakers, panels, and conduits
Troubleshoot electrical issues and resolve them efficiently and safely
Read and interpret complex blueprints, wiring diagrams, and schematics
Install and repair electrical systems in new and existing buildings, including upgrades
Operate and use hand tools, electrical meters, power tools, and diagnostic hardware to perform installations and repairs
Maintain compliance with local, state, and national electrical codes and regulations
Test electrical systems and ensure proper functionality after installation or repair
Collaborate with other trades as needed, especially in commercial environments with overlapping systems
Work with and install various electrical components in both residential and commercial settings, including lighting systems, electrical circuits, and more
Perform preventive maintenance on electrical systems, identifying issues before they cause system failures
Maintain a safe and clean work site, complying with all company policies and safety standards
Keep Jet vehicles clean at all times
Requisition material and supplies as needed from the stockroom or vendors
Work may take place in cramped, dirty/dusty, cold, or hot conditions. Safety precautions must be taken when dealing with live electrical wiring and hazardous conditions
